STATE v. WILLIAMS

No. 82-KA-240.

430 So.2d 782 (1983)

STATE of Louisiana v. Welton WILLIAMS.

Court of Appeal of Louisiana, Fifth Circuit.

April 11, 1983.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Martha E. Sassone, 24th Judicial Dist. Indigent Defender Bd., Gretna, for defendant/appellant.

William C. Credo, III, Louise Korns, Asst. Dist. Attys., Gretna, for State/appellee.

Before BOUTALL, KLIEBERT and BOWES, JJ.


BOWES, Judge.

Defendant appeals the July 7, 1982 sentence of the district court imposed as a result of defendant's plea of guilty to the reduced charge of aggravated battery. We affirm the sentence of the district court.
